Editorial: Real Estate in California

Fifty-five leading real estate attorneys were chosen for this chapter. They have a wide range of specialisms from real estate funding to land use and sales. Although in the past year there has been a reported fall in the price of housing and commercial property markets in California, the talent of these lawyers has enabled them to maintain strong real estate practices.

DLA Piper leads the field with seven "excellent partners" in this chapter. Pamela Westhoff specialises in acquisitions, dispositions, commercial leasing and technology issues affecting real property. She was recommended for her "fantastic work". Caryl Welborn practises transactional real estate and entity structuring and was praised for her "comprehensive knowledge". She has represented developers, institutional lenders and investors, banks, insurance companies, funds, and other entities in projects across the country. Michael Meyer is the managing partner of the Los Angeles area offices and was recommended for his "specialist knowledge" in leasing. He has represented a number of financial institutions in leasing transactions including Bank of America, City National Bank, The Capital Group and TCW. Richard Mendelson works across all aspects of commercial and residential property. His clients have included domestic and international banks and other financial institutions, insurance companies, pension funds and major developers. Stephen Cowan specialises in the corporate aspects of the creation of real estate funds through private placements. He worked on the $1.7 billion multi-property acquisition for Irvine Diversified and the sale of a $500 million office complex in Century City. Alan Wayte is an "expert" in California and works in real estate finance, purchases and workouts. His clients have included insurance companies, banks and pension funds. John Whitaker advises domestic and international clients in the areas of sale, acquisition and development of real property. His work includes the transfer of excess density rights and negotiation of agreements with redevelopment agencies. He also advises clients on eminent domain issues affecting their property. He is known, among other things, for his work in downtown Los Angeles and has assisted clients in the acquisition of office buildings, shopping centres, hotels and residential properties in the area.

William Murray is the chair of the global real estate group at Orrick Herrington & Sutcliffe LLP and is based in San Francisco. He has worked on the securitisation of real estate assets and pension fund investment in real estate. His clients have included pension funds, individual developers, domestic institutions and foreign investors and he was described as a "great lawyer". The "inspirational" Noel Nellis is also based in the San Francisco office and is responsible for the global real estate group. He has worked on large-scale land development projects including office buildings resort properties and industrial buildings. He has also worked with real estate trusts throughout California. Michael McAndrews represents real estate investment funds, banks, developers and corporate clients in investment, financing, acquisition and disposition and corporate real estate activities. He acted on behalf of a major real estate investment fund in the $140 million sale of a hotel in Hawaii and has also represented similar funds in subscription facility financings of $275 million, $425 million and $250 million. Michael Liever was named as "one of the best in Los Angeles" and has represented a wide range of national and international clients in acquisition, disposition and development of office buildings, industrial parks and apartments. His clients have included Cabot Industrial Trust, New York Life Insurance and Alecta Investments Management.

Anton Natsis is the chairman of Allen Matkins Leck Gamble Mallory & Natsis LLP's real estate practice and a "first-choice selection". He has assisted many national landowners such as JP Morgan Asset Management, Blackstone Real Estate and Brookfield Properties. His governmental entities have included LAUSD, the state of California and the city of Anaheim. Richard Mallory is co-managing partner of the San Francisco office and specialises in commercial and industrial leasing. He has worked both on the side of this landlord and on the side of the tenant in leasing issues, including renewals and telecommunications transactions. Michael Matkins specialises in real estate development and was described as "simply fantastic". He has advised institutional investors, lenders, property owners and developers in all aspects of purchase, sale, financing, leasing and construction of properties ranging from office and retail to recreational and mixed-use projects. He has worked on multimillion-dollar portfolio acquisitions and has negotiated hotel management contracts for a number of large companies. Bruce Hyman is of counsel in the firm's San Francisco office and was noted for his "wide reaching experience" in all areas of real estate law. He was also mentioned for his public speaking at the Practising Law Institute, National Association of Real Estate Investment Trusts and Continuing Education for the Bar of the California State Bar.

Jesse Sharf, co-chair of Gibson Dunn & Crutcher LLP's real estate department is a "pleasure to work with". He has been active in representing real estate funds in their formation, investment and financing activities, and lenders in a wide range of real estate issues. Dennis Arnold has worked on all aspects of commercial and residential real estate and one source described him as being "enormously smart". He is also an experienced speaker and has given lectures at the American College of Real Estate Lawyers, the American Bar Association and the Practising Law Institute. Amy Forbes specialises in land use planning. Forbes is currently acting as counsel to Stockbridge Land in connection with the development of Bay Meadows Racetrack, as well as the Fashion Institute of Design and Merchandising. Michael Sfregola focuses on the acquisition and financing of hotel, resort, commercial, industrial and residential properties. He has worked on major portfolio acquisitions from both private and public sellers in the United States and Asia.

Ira Waldman of Cox Castle & Nicholson LLP represents lenders and developers in all areas of real estate including secured lender remedies, property disposition, leasing activities and workouts. He was described as a "top-tier practitioner". Phillip Nicholson is held in "very high regard" by one source, who recommended him for his experience and "commitment to teamwork". Mathew Wyman has represented developers, pension funds, foreign and domestic investors on a wide range of real estate issues. "Fantastic" Ron Silverman is a former chair of the Real Property Section of the Los Angeles County Bar Association. He specialises in the land use and entitlement transactions.

Three "smart lawyers" were recommended at Sheppard Mullin Richter & Hampton LLP. Robert Williams was described as a "guiding light in affordable housing", having worked with non-profit developers. Joan Story specialises in real estate investment, financing and leasing transactions and has represented DHL Express. Robert Thompson has acted as counsel to clients including The Sea Ranch in Sonoma County, San Francisco Centre and the Fillmore Centre, as well as a number of San Francisco office projects.

Three of the founding members of Pircher Nichols & Meeks were chosen for our listings: Phillip Nichols, Stevens Carey and Leo Pircher. All three work in the firm's real estate department and are "well respected and professional lawyers". The firm has represented real estate clients throughout the US including Playa Vista, Blackstone Realty Advisors and the Wells Fargo Centre in California.

O'Malley Miller of Munger Tolles & Olson LLP was described as "highly professional" and specialises in real property finance and development issues. His colleague Richard Volpert is an "excellent practitioner" who focuses on the planning and development of large-scale real estate projects including major office buildings, shopping centres and planned communities.

Don Berger from Latham & Watkins LLP specialises in the financing of real estate projects and has represents investment banks, real estate funds and other institutional clients. George Mihlsten was recommended for his transactional work, which has included projects for the Staples Centre arena and The Walt Disney Company.

At Ellman Burke Hoffman & Johnson, the "outstanding" Howard Ellman was chosen for his vast and diverse experience, while James Stillman was described as "one of the smartest real estate bankruptcy lawyers in the business".

Philip Feder and Charles Thornton were selected from Paul Hastings Janofsky & Walker LLP. Chairman of the firm's global real estate practice, Feder specialises in representing US-based investors around the world and works from London and Los Angeles. Thornton is in charge of the firm's San Francisco office and was nominated for his "impressive financing deals".

The "very bright" Luis Eatman from Proskauer Rose LLP gained a top ranking and was described as a "trusted contact". He has experience of working with banks, life insurance companies, pension funds and their advisers, private equity funds, REITs, portfolio asset managers, commercial landlords and tenants, and other institutional mortgage lenders and investors.

Pamela Duffy of Coblentz Patch Duffy & Bass LLP was named as a "top choice for land use". She has acted in a number of major development projects and real estate transactions, including the two largest development projects in San Francisco. Her clients have included Prologis, Forest City Enterprises, Cadence Designs Systems and ebay.

Judith Miles recently became of counsel in Goodwin Procter LLP. Prior to joining the firm, Miles was co-chair of Heller Ehrman LLP's real estate practice until the firm's dissolution in 2008. She was nominated for her "very good work" encompassing a broad range of commercial real estate matters including hotel transactions, joint ventures, sales and acquisitions. Dean Pappas, also at Goodwin Procter, is especially recommended for his real estate finance work, which includes forming joint ventures and real estate capital markets.

Independent practitioner, Susan Reid of The Law Offices of Susan M Reid was named as a "highly professional and intelligent" practitioner. She is a member of the American College of Real Estate lawyers.

Michael Dean has been a partner in Wendel Rosen Black & Dean LLP since 1967 and was described as "one of the
best in Oakland". He focuses on commercial development, leasing and financing matters.

Lance Bocarsly is a founding partner in boutique law firm Bocarsly Emden Cowan Esmail Parker & Arndt LLP. He is "highly recommended" and was recognised for his work in affordable housing. He also specialises in community and economic development transactions.

David Van Atta also joins the list from a specialist law firm, Hanna & Van Atta. He was named for his writings on real estate development and was described as a "true expert" in the area. He is especially well known for his work on mixed-use developments.

Roy Geiger was recognised for his "excellent" real estate financial advice in Irell & Manella LLP's Newport Beach office. He has represented clients in major financings and workouts, representing both borrowers and lenders.

Sheldon Rubin is a founding member of Rubin & Eagan APC and is based in Los Angeles. He was recommended for his "fantastic" work in title insurance. He is the chair of the ACREL international title assurance subcommittee.

Charles Trainor of Trainor Fairbrook was highly rated in our survey and praised for his "superb" work in real estate transactions. He also counsels lenders on mortgage origination and workout matters, and advises tenants and landlords in office and retail leases.

Steven Dyer of Horan Lloyd Karachale Dyer Schwartz Law & Cook Incorporated practises in real estate transactions, finance, land use and water law, and business transactions. One source described him as "the top guy in Monterey".
Robert Caplan is the managing member of Seltzer Caplan McMahon Vitek and is based in San Diego. He specialises in retail, office, industrial, residential and mixed-use projects and was a popular choice.

Stephen Cassidy founded Cassidy Shimko Dawson & Kawakami in 1990 and has specialised in land use and real estate law since 1975. His clients have included Cornell University, Elliot Homes and Pixar Animation Studios.

Robert Herr of Pillsbury Winthrop Shaw Pittman LLP specialises in development, acquisition, operation and loan transactions. He acted as lead attorney in the acquisition of the San Francisco Giants by the current ownership group of the Major League Baseball franchise, including the team's $350 million ballpark.

The "excellent" Carl Seneker of Morrison & Foerster LLP was recommended for his commercial transactions knowledge. He has represented national and international clients including Divco West Properties in closing an acquisition agreement and ground lease for the Clift Hotel in San Francisco and for the later sale of the lease.
